Jersey Mike’s (NYSE:JMKE – Get Free Report) major shareholder Abu Dhabi Investment Authority sold 382,134 shares of the business’s stock in a transaction that occurred on Tuesday, August 25th. The shares were sold at an average price of $21.85, for a total transaction of $8,349,627.90. Following the transaction, the insider directly owned 35,732,138 shares of the company’s stock, valued at approximately $780,747,215.30. This represents a 1.06% decrease in their position. The sale was disclosed in a filing with the SEC, which is available through the SEC website. Major shareholders that own 10% or more of a company’s shares are required to disclose their sales and purchases with the SEC.

About Jersey Mike’s
We are Jersey Mike’s: A high-growth franchisor of fast casual, submarine-style sandwich restaurants specializing in authentic, hand-crafted, craveable subs. Built over 70 years on one uncompromising belief – that a truly great sub sandwich can change your day and that a truly great brand changes its community – Jersey Mike’s is now one of the largest and fastest-growing limited-service restaurant brands based on U.S. systemwide sales and unit growth, with 3,300 stores across all 50 states and two countries – nearly all of which are franchised.
